Output 31f216b4fccca538d2c40f8257799a8e4181d883636e77ab6b8864772c062b96:0

value
14559590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ceb86016b8c1543702bead21439915bde09d689 OP_EQUALVERIFY OP_CHECKSIG
address
156Wsu3kbzWxv1g85Qavqw51DG4jsCK7oF
transaction
31f216b4fccca538d2c40f8257799a8e4181d883636e77ab6b8864772c062b96
confirmations
530520
spent
true